
Digital Radiography (DRT) vs. Conventional Film RT: When to Choose Each Method?
Radiographic testing is a cornerstone of non-destructive testing (NDT), providing critical insights into the internal integrity of welds, pipelines, pressure vessels, and structural components. With the evolution of inspection technologies, Digital Radiographic Testing (DRT) has emerged as an advanced alternative to the traditional Film Radiography (RT) method. But when is it best to use DRT over Film RT? Let’s break down the differences, benefits, and recommended applications.What Is Digital Radiography (DRT)?
Digital Radiography is a modern radiographic method that captures images electronically using flat panel detectors or computed radiography plates. Unlike traditional methods, DRT delivers instant, high-resolution digital images, eliminating the need for film development and chemical processing.Advantages of Digital Radiography
- Instant Results: Images can be viewed within seconds, improving turnaround time significantly.
- Lower Radiation Dose: DRT systems often require less exposure than film-based methods.
- Digital Archiving: Inspection data can be easily stored, retrieved, and shared across teams.
- Enhanced Analysis: Software tools allow inspectors to zoom, measure, and enhance contrast for more precise evaluations.
What Is Conventional Film Radiography (RT)?
Film RT uses traditional X-ray or gamma ray exposure on radiographic film to create an image. The exposed film is developed using chemical processing in a darkroom, producing a physical film that must be reviewed manually.Strengths of Film Radiography
- High Image Resolution: Film offers very fine detail that is often superior for detecting tiny discontinuities.
- Standards Compliance: Many industry codes and clients still require film-based inspection as a baseline method.
- Familiarity: Long-standing practice means that film RT is widely understood by regulators and clients.
- Long-Term Proven Method: Over 100 years of field application and reliability.
DRT vs. Film RT: Head-to-Head Comparison
| Feature | Digital Radiography (DRT) | Conventional Film RT |
|---|---|---|
| Image Availability | Instant (Real-time or near real-time) | Delayed (Chemical film processing required) |
| Radiation Exposure | Lower in many cases | Higher exposure time and dose |
| Portability | Compact and suitable for field applications | Requires more equipment, including darkroom |
| Compliance | Accepted in modern standards (ASME V, ISO 17636-2) | Mandatory in legacy codes and client-specific specs |
| Archiving | Cloud/Digital storage | Physical film storage needed |
When Should You Use Each Method?
Choose Film RT If:
- Industry standards or client specifications demand film-based records
- You need ultra-high resolution for very fine defect detection
- Project stakeholders prefer hard copy evidence
Choose DRT If:
- Speed, flexibility, and efficiency are priorities
- You want to reduce inspection costs and exposure time
- You require digital storage, remote access, or cloud-based reporting
